What Are Etsy Trending Searches?
Etsy trending searches are what buyers are actively searching for, right now. In 2026, top Etsy searches are leaning heavily into sustainability, personalization, and bold aesthetics, with products like engraved jewelry, eco-friendly goods, and nostalgic home decor leading the charge.

Why Trending Searches Matter for Print on Demand Sellers
When you’re on Etsy, the competition is fierce. Every product listing is like a tiny warrior fighting for visibility among thousands of others. Understanding what’s trending gives you an advantage.
Here’s why keeping tabs on Etsy trending searches matters:
- Visibility: Etsy’s search algorithm rewards listings with keywords that match current buyer demand. In other words, tapping into top searches improves your chances of landing on the first page of potential buyers’ Etsy search results—prime real estate for organic traffic.
- Improved Conversion Rates: When you know what shoppers are searching for, you can create product offerings that sell. Relevant keywords in your titles, tags, and product descriptions related to these trends can turn a casual browser into a buyer.
- Stay Competitive: As I watch the statistics in my own store, I realize that search volume for keywords changes over time. Searches keep evolving with the trends. By aligning with current Etsy keyword trends, you’re staying ahead of the curve—and your competitors. But if you have something that is selling, DO NOT CHANGE THE KEYWORDS!
- Informed Design Decisions: If you’re crushing it with print-on-demand, it’s essential to create designs that resonate with current trends—like Mocha Mousse-inspired tones or playful, nostalgic graphics that have high search volume.
Where to Find Etsy Trending Searches
So, how do you find out what’s buzzing on Etsy?
Here are some places to start:
- Etsy’s Trend Page: This is your first stop. Etsy curates a “Trending Now” page to help sellers see what’s currently hot.
- Third-Party Keyword Tools: Platforms like eRank, and EHunt are built specifically for Etsy SEO. They break down keyword data and give you insight into low-competition search terms, high-demand products, and trending items. However, sometimes Etsy trending searches take a while to appear on these keyword tools. From my experience in my shop, if I find a trend, but the data is non-existent on these tools, I will list something anyway.
- Google Trends and Pinterest Predicts: These tools might not focus solely on Etsy, but they’re excellent for seeing broader trends that could affect your product development. For instance, Pinterest Predicts highlights upcoming styles and popular products, making it an excellent source of fresh ideas. I highly recommend for trend information and design inspiration.
- Your Own Etsy Stats Dashboard: The data doesn’t lie. Use the analytics tool built into your Etsy shop to check your own sales metrics and see which keywords are bringing traffic. If you notice a spike in views for specific terms, act on it.
- Etsy Search Bar Autocomplete: This is an underrated strategy. Start typing something into Etsy’s search bar, and boom—you’ve got a list of popular, related keywords handed to you. Those are buyer-driven keywords already predicted by Etsy API.
Every one of these tools is a powerful way to get closer to your audience, understand the most popular keywords in real time, and position your Etsy store for the best results.
Combine the insights you get from these sources to create unique product listings that scream “just what you’re looking for!”

‘Core’ Trends: Knightcore, Castlecore, Cutecore, & Hopecore
Core-driven trends are taking over. In 2026, Knightcore, Castlecore, and the uplifting optimism of Hopecore are dominating search bars. These are more than just styles—they’re entire mood boards brought into reality.
- Knightcore and Castlecore: Think glittering crowns, velvet textures, and items that look like they belong in a Bridgerton ballroom or medieval castle.
- Hopecore and Cutecore: These core aesthetics are a breath of fresh air—literally. Hopecore is centered around themes of optimism and renewal. For those of you who want to break into the positivity niche, this is your chance. Cutecore is an aesthetic centered around all things adorable, emphasizing pastel colors, playful designs, and a childlike sense of whimsy and joy.

Unique Themes: Fisherman Aesthetic and Sardines
Okay, let’s talk about some themes we didn’t see coming—because Etsy shoppers are unpredictable in the most fun ways.
- Fisherman Aesthetic: This vibe leans into coastal nostalgia and everyday fisherman gear. What’s selling now? I’ve seen a bestselling sweatshirt with illustrations of rainbow trout. So simple!
- Sardine-Themed Products: Sardines? Yes, you read that right. I’ve been minimalist sweatshirts with sardine illustrations selling well. I’ve also seen vintage sardine cans on shirts that have been selling too! So
Nature and Novelty: Snakes and Cherries
Nature-inspired products with a touch of novelty are Etsy trends that never seem to fade. Seriously, food and animals will always do well on Etsy. Its different types that will trend. In 2026, snakes and cherries are slithering (and sweetly sitting, in cherries’ case) their way to the top of trending searches.
- Snakes: Buyers are leaning into edgy, bold vibes. But, also I’ve seen boho-style snakes on t-shirts and sweatshirts that are selling very well. Snakes are trending now, but the keyword was in high demand in 2023 also.
- Cherries: Cute, nostalgic, and versatile—this trend gives us summer picnic energy. Sellers are using cherries in everything from bright, playful designs to retro-inspired patterns. Cherries were also very hot in 2023 and 2024, so this trend is continuing into 2026.
This combo of nature and novelty gives your store a unique angle while tapping into two high-demand markets.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Targeting Etsy Trends
Chasing Etsy trends can be like trying to catch a wave, when done right, you’ll ride it to success. But when you miss the nuances, you might find yourself spinning without progress.
Let’s look at a couple of pitfalls you don’t want to fall into.
Ignoring Analytics & Feedback
Your Etsy store gives you all the data you need, but so many sellers brush it under the rug.
Here’s what’s clear: to align with trending searches, you need to monitor how your listings perform. Analytics are your map.
Check your sales metrics, see what brings traffic, and spot which keywords spark engagement. If “90s vintage mug” is killing it on your neon mugs listing, expand that keyword strategy into other products.
But don’t stop there—your customers are spilling their thoughts for free in reviews and messages.
Maybe several customers loved the product’s look but wished for a specific color sweatshirt. That’s golden intel to refine your product offerings, especially when riding on trends where quality and uniqueness are crucial.
Remember, trends aren’t one-size-fits-all. Use your shop’s data as a guiding compass in Etsy’s search ocean. It’s important data.
Focusing Solely on Short-Term Trends
Trends come and go. Some stay around longer and some are in and out in a flash. What you need is a mix of high-demand, low-competition keywords that cater to ongoing customer desires and not just fleeting aesthetics.
Instead of going all in on something that’s “trending now,” try to use long-tail keywords like “minimalist hopecore pillow” alongside evergreen phrases like “handmade home decor.”
By balancing short trends with timeless appeal, you’re building a shop that’s always ready for the next wave of Etsy shoppers without losing itself in the process.
